It’s been just under a week since the last iOS 11 beta, and now Apple has released the tenth developer beta preview. iOS 11 brings new features like drag-and-drop and a redesigned multitasking interface for iPad, a new customizable Control Center, and much more. iOS 11 public beta 9 is also available.

iOS 11 beta 10 is currently only available to registered developers for now. Apple typically holds new public beta versions for a few days for major updates, although recent versions have launched on the same day. [Update: Yep, both are available.]

Apple’s previous iOS 11 betas introduced new Maps and App Store icons and other refinements. As we approach the final release next month, we expect more stability and fewer noticeable changes.
